Acclaimed Director Anand Ekarshi Explores Love and Relationships in Captivating Short Film

In October 2025, acclaimed director Anand Ekarshi is making waves with his latest project - a captivating short film titled "Isle Of The Golden Swan". The film, which features veteran actor Prakash Raj in a major role, delves into the complexities of human relationships and the true nature of love.

Ekarshi, known for his National Award-winning film "Aattam", has incorporated the traditional Indian art form of Koodiyattam into the short's narrative. The story revolves around a grandfather-granddaughter dynamic and the people around them, exploring psychological elements and the question of whether we truly love those we claim to.

The director reveals that Prakash Raj, who had previously praised Ekarshi's work, joined the project just 5 days before filming was set to begin. Despite his illustrious career and accolades, Raj worked on the short film for free, driven by his passion for the script and the team's dedication. Ekarshi describes the experience of working with Raj as "a big realisation", praising the actor's grounded nature and ease of collaboration.

With a talented crew including editor Mahesh Bhuvanend, sound designer Renganaath Ravee, and composer Basil CJ - all of whom had worked on "Aattam" - "Isle Of The Golden Swan" promises to be a captivating exploration of love, relationships, and the human condition.
